   -----------------------------------------
   -- Expand_Dispatching_Constructor_Call --
   -----------------------------------------

   --  Transform a call to an instantiation of Generic_Dispatching_Constructor
   --  of the form:

   --     GDC_Instance (The_Tag, Parameters'Access)

   --  to a class-wide conversion of a dispatching call to the actual
   --  associated with the formal subprogram Construct, designating The_Tag
   --  as the controlling tag of the call:

   --     T'Class (Construct'Actual (Params)) -- Controlling tag is The_Tag

   --  which will eventually be expanded to the following:

   --     T'Class (The_Tag.all (Construct'Actual'Index).all (Params))

   --  A class-wide membership test is also generated, preceding the call, to
   --  ensure that the controlling tag denotes a type in T'Class.

   procedure Expand_Dispatching_Constructor_Call (N : Node_Id) is
      Loc        : constant Source_Ptr := Sloc (N);
      Tag_Arg    : constant Node_Id    := First_Actual (N);
      Param_Arg  : constant Node_Id    := Next_Actual (Tag_Arg);
      Subp_Decl  : constant Node_Id    := Parent (Parent (Entity (Name (N))));
      Inst_Pkg   : constant Node_Id    := Parent (Subp_Decl);
      Act_Rename : Node_Id;
      Act_Constr : Entity_Id;
      Iface_Tag  : Node_Id := Empty;
      Cnstr_Call : Node_Id;
      Result_Typ : Entity_Id;

   begin
      --  Remove side effects from tag argument early, before rewriting
      --  the dispatching constructor call, as Remove_Side_Effects relies
      --  on Tag_Arg's Parent link properly attached to the tree (once the
      --  call is rewritten, the Parent is inconsistent as it points to the
      --  rewritten node, which is not the syntactic parent of the Tag_Arg
      --  anymore).

      Remove_Side_Effects (Tag_Arg);

      --  The subprogram is the third actual in the instantiation, and is
      --  retrieved from the corresponding renaming declaration. However,
      --  freeze nodes may appear before, so we retrieve the declaration
      --  with an explicit loop.

      Act_Rename := First (Visible_Declarations (Inst_Pkg));
      while Nkind (Act_Rename) /= N_Subprogram_Renaming_Declaration loop
         Next (Act_Rename);
      end loop;

      Act_Constr := Entity (Name (Act_Rename));
      Result_Typ := Class_Wide_Type (Etype (Act_Constr));

      if Is_Interface (Etype (Act_Constr)) then

         --  If the result type is not known to be a parent of Tag_Arg then we
         --  need to locate the tag of the secondary dispatch table.

         if not Is_Ancestor (Etype (Result_Typ), Etype (Tag_Arg),
                             Use_Full_View => True)
           and then Tagged_Type_Expansion
         then
            --  Obtain the reference to the Ada.Tags service before generating
            --  the Object_Declaration node to ensure that if this service is
            --  not available in the runtime then we generate a clear error.

            declare
               Fname : constant Node_Id :=
                         New_Occurrence_Of (RTE (RE_Secondary_Tag), Loc);

            begin
               pragma Assert (not Is_Interface (Etype (Tag_Arg)));

               Iface_Tag :=
                 Make_Object_Declaration (Loc,
                   Defining_Identifier => Make_Temporary (Loc, 'V'),
                   Object_Definition   =>
                     New_Occurrence_Of (RTE (RE_Tag), Loc),
                   Expression          =>
                     Make_Function_Call (Loc,
                       Name                   => Fname,
                       Parameter_Associations => New_List (
                         Relocate_Node (Tag_Arg),
                         New_Occurrence_Of
                           (Node (First_Elmt (Access_Disp_Table
                                               (Etype (Etype (Act_Constr))))),
                            Loc))));
               Insert_Action (N, Iface_Tag);
            end;
         end if;
      end if;

      --  Create the call to the actual Constructor function

      Cnstr_Call :=
        Make_Function_Call (Loc,
          Name                   => New_Occurrence_Of (Act_Constr, Loc),
          Parameter_Associations => New_List (Relocate_Node (Param_Arg)));

      --  Establish its controlling tag from the tag passed to the instance
      --  The tag may be given by a function call, in which case a temporary
      --  should be generated now, to prevent out-of-order insertions during
      --  the expansion of that call when stack-checking is enabled.

      if Present (Iface_Tag) then
         Set_Controlling_Argument (Cnstr_Call,
           New_Occurrence_Of (Defining_Identifier (Iface_Tag), Loc));
      else
         Set_Controlling_Argument (Cnstr_Call,
           Relocate_Node (Tag_Arg));
      end if;

      --  Rewrite and analyze the call to the instance as a class-wide
      --  conversion of the call to the actual constructor.

      Rewrite (N, Convert_To (Result_Typ, Cnstr_Call));
      Analyze_And_Resolve (N, Etype (Act_Constr));

      --  Do not generate a run-time check on the built object if tag
      --  checks are suppressed for the result type or VM_Target /= No_VM

      if Tag_Checks_Suppressed (Etype (Result_Typ))
        or else not Tagged_Type_Expansion
      then
         null;

      --  Generate a class-wide membership test to ensure that the call's tag
      --  argument denotes a type within the class. We must keep separate the
      --  case in which the Result_Type of the constructor function is a tagged
      --  type from the case in which it is an abstract interface because the
      --  run-time subprogram required to check these cases differ (and have
      --  one difference in their parameters profile).

      --  Call CW_Membership if the Result_Type is a tagged type to look for
      --  the tag in the table of ancestor tags.

      elsif not Is_Interface (Result_Typ) then
         declare
            Obj_Tag_Node : Node_Id := New_Copy_Tree (Tag_Arg);
            CW_Test_Node : Node_Id;

         begin
            Build_CW_Membership (Loc,
              Obj_Tag_Node => Obj_Tag_Node,
              Typ_Tag_Node =>
                New_Occurrence_Of (
                   Node (First_Elmt (Access_Disp_Table (
                                       Root_Type (Result_Typ)))), Loc),
              Related_Nod => N,
              New_Node    => CW_Test_Node);

            Insert_Action (N,
              Make_Implicit_If_Statement (N,
                Condition =>
                  Make_Op_Not (Loc, CW_Test_Node),
                Then_Statements =>
                  New_List (Make_Raise_Statement (Loc,
                              New_Occurrence_Of (RTE (RE_Tag_Error), Loc)))));
         end;

      --  Call IW_Membership test if the Result_Type is an abstract interface
      --  to look for the tag in the table of interface tags.

      else
         Insert_Action (N,
           Make_Implicit_If_Statement (N,
             Condition =>
               Make_Op_Not (Loc,
                 Make_Function_Call (Loc,
                    Name => New_Occurrence_Of (RTE (RE_IW_Membership), Loc),
                    Parameter_Associations => New_List (
                      Make_Attribute_Reference (Loc,
                        Prefix         => New_Copy_Tree (Tag_Arg),
                        Attribute_Name => Name_Address),

                      New_Occurrence_Of (
                        Node (First_Elmt (Access_Disp_Table (
                                            Root_Type (Result_Typ)))), Loc)))),
             Then_Statements =>
               New_List (
                 Make_Raise_Statement (Loc,
                   Name => New_Occurrence_Of (RTE (RE_Tag_Error), Loc)))));
      end if;
   end Expand_Dispatching_Constructor_Call;

   ------------------
   -- Expand_Shift --
   ------------------

   --  This procedure is used to convert a call to a shift function to the
   --  corresponding operator node. This conversion is not done by the usual
   --  circuit for converting calls to operator functions (e.g. "+"(1,2)) to
   --  operator nodes, because shifts are not predefined operators.

   --  As a result, whenever a shift is used in the source program, it will
   --  remain as a call until converted by this routine to the operator node
   --  form which the back end is expecting to see.

   --  Note: it is possible for the expander to generate shift operator nodes
   --  directly, which will be analyzed in the normal manner by calling Analyze
   --  and Resolve. Such shift operator nodes will not be seen by Expand_Shift.

   procedure Expand_Shift (N : Node_Id; E : Entity_Id; K : Node_Kind) is
      Entyp : constant Entity_Id  := Etype (E);
      Left  : constant Node_Id    := First_Actual (N);
      Loc   : constant Source_Ptr := Sloc (N);
      Right : constant Node_Id    := Next_Actual (Left);
      Ltyp  : constant Node_Id    := Etype (Left);
      Rtyp  : constant Node_Id    := Etype (Right);
      Typ   : constant Entity_Id  := Etype (N);
      Snode : Node_Id;

   begin
      Snode := New_Node (K, Loc);
      Set_Right_Opnd (Snode, Relocate_Node (Right));
      Set_Chars      (Snode, Chars (E));
      Set_Etype      (Snode, Base_Type (Entyp));
      Set_Entity     (Snode, E);

      if Compile_Time_Known_Value (Type_High_Bound (Rtyp))
        and then Expr_Value (Type_High_Bound (Rtyp)) < Esize (Ltyp)
      then
         Set_Shift_Count_OK (Snode, True);
      end if;

      if Typ = Entyp then

         --  Note that we don't call Analyze and Resolve on this node, because
         --  it already got analyzed and resolved when it was a function call.

         Set_Left_Opnd (Snode, Relocate_Node (Left));
         Rewrite (N, Snode);
         Set_Analyzed (N);

         --  However, we do call the expander, so that the expansion for
         --  rotates and shift_right_arithmetic happens if Modify_Tree_For_C
         --  is set.

         if Expander_Active then
            Expand (N);
         end if;

      else
         --  If the context type is not the type of the operator, it is an
         --  inherited operator for a derived type. Wrap the node in a
         --  conversion so that it is type-consistent for possible further
         --  expansion (e.g. within a lock-free protected type).

         Set_Left_Opnd (Snode,
           Unchecked_Convert_To (Base_Type (Entyp), Relocate_Node (Left)));
         Rewrite (N, Unchecked_Convert_To (Typ, Snode));

         --  Analyze and resolve result formed by conversion to target type

         Analyze_And_Resolve (N, Typ);
      end if;
   end Expand_Shift;

   -----------------------------
   -- Expand_Unc_Deallocation --
   -----------------------------

   --  Generate the following Code :

   --    if Arg /= null then
   --     <Finalize_Call> (.., T'Class(Arg.all), ..);  -- for controlled types
   --       Free (Arg);
   --       Arg := Null;
   --    end if;

   --  For a task, we also generate a call to Free_Task to ensure that the
   --  task itself is freed if it is terminated, ditto for a simple protected
   --  object, with a call to Finalize_Protection. For composite types that
   --  have tasks or simple protected objects as components, we traverse the
   --  structures to find and terminate those components.

   procedure Expand_Unc_Deallocation (N : Node_Id) is
      Arg       : constant Node_Id    := First_Actual (N);
      Loc       : constant Source_Ptr := Sloc (N);
      Typ       : constant Entity_Id  := Etype (Arg);
      Desig_T   : constant Entity_Id  := Designated_Type (Typ);
      Rtyp      : constant Entity_Id  := Underlying_Type (Root_Type (Typ));
      Pool      : constant Entity_Id  := Associated_Storage_Pool (Rtyp);
      Stmts     : constant List_Id    := New_List;
      Needs_Fin : constant Boolean    := Needs_Finalization (Desig_T);

      Finalizer_Data  : Finalization_Exception_Data;

      Blk        : Node_Id := Empty;
      Deref      : Node_Id;
      Final_Code : List_Id;
      Free_Arg   : Node_Id;
      Free_Node  : Node_Id;
      Gen_Code   : Node_Id;

      Arg_Known_Non_Null : constant Boolean := Known_Non_Null (N);
      --  This captures whether we know the argument to be non-null so that
      --  we can avoid the test. The reason that we need to capture this is
      --  that we analyze some generated statements before properly attaching
      --  them to the tree, and that can disturb current value settings.

   begin
      --  Nothing to do if we know the argument is null

      if Known_Null (N) then
         return;
      end if;

      --  Processing for pointer to controlled type

      if Needs_Fin then
         Deref :=
           Make_Explicit_Dereference (Loc,
             Prefix => Duplicate_Subexpr_No_Checks (Arg));

         --  If the type is tagged, then we must force dispatching on the
         --  finalization call because the designated type may not be the
         --  actual type of the object.

         if Is_Tagged_Type (Desig_T)
           and then not Is_Class_Wide_Type (Desig_T)
         then
            Deref := Unchecked_Convert_To (Class_Wide_Type (Desig_T), Deref);

         elsif not Is_Tagged_Type (Desig_T) then

            --  Set type of result, to force a conversion when needed (see
            --  exp_ch7, Convert_View), given that Deep_Finalize may be
            --  inherited from the parent type, and we need the type of the
            --  expression to see whether the conversion is in fact needed.

            Set_Etype (Deref, Desig_T);
         end if;

         --  The finalization call is expanded wrapped in a block to catch any
         --  possible exception. If an exception does occur, then Program_Error
         --  must be raised following the freeing of the object and its removal
         --  from the finalization collection's list. We set a flag to record
         --  that an exception was raised, and save its occurrence for use in
         --  the later raise.
         --
         --  Generate:
         --    Abort  : constant Boolean :=
         --               Exception_Occurrence (Get_Current_Excep.all.all) =
         --                 Standard'Abort_Signal'Identity;
         --      <or>
         --    Abort  : constant Boolean := False;  --  no abort

         --    E      : Exception_Occurrence;
         --    Raised : Boolean := False;
         --
         --    begin
         --       [Deep_]Finalize (Obj);
         --    exception
         --       when others =>
         --          Raised := True;
         --          Save_Occurrence (E, Get_Current_Excep.all.all);
         --    end;

         Build_Object_Declarations (Finalizer_Data, Stmts, Loc);

         Final_Code := New_List (
           Make_Block_Statement (Loc,
             Handled_Statement_Sequence =>
               Make_Handled_Sequence_Of_Statements (Loc,
                 Statements         => New_List (
                   Make_Final_Call (Obj_Ref => Deref, Typ => Desig_T)),
                 Exception_Handlers => New_List (
                   Build_Exception_Handler (Finalizer_Data)))));

         --  For .NET/JVM, detach the object from the containing finalization
         --  collection before finalizing it.

         if VM_Target /= No_VM and then Is_Controlled (Desig_T) then
            Prepend_To (Final_Code,
              Make_Detach_Call (New_Copy_Tree (Arg)));
         end if;

         --  If aborts are allowed, then the finalization code must be
         --  protected by an abort defer/undefer pair.

         if Abort_Allowed then
            Prepend_To (Final_Code,
              Build_Runtime_Call (Loc, RE_Abort_Defer));

            Blk :=
              Make_Block_Statement (Loc, Handled_Statement_Sequence =>
                Make_Handled_Sequence_Of_Statements (Loc,
                  Statements  => Final_Code,
                  At_End_Proc =>
                    New_Occurrence_Of (RTE (RE_Abort_Undefer_Direct), Loc)));

            Append (Blk, Stmts);
         else
            Append_List_To (Stmts, Final_Code);
         end if;
      end if;

      --  For a task type, call Free_Task before freeing the ATCB

      if Is_Task_Type (Desig_T) then

         --  We used to detect the case of Abort followed by a Free here,
         --  because the Free wouldn't actually free if it happens before
         --  the aborted task actually terminates. The warning was removed,
         --  because Free now works properly (the task will be freed once
         --  it terminates).

         Append_To
           (Stmts, Cleanup_Task (N, Duplicate_Subexpr_No_Checks (Arg)));

      --  For composite types that contain tasks, recurse over the structure
      --  to build the selectors for the task subcomponents.

      elsif Has_Task (Desig_T) then
         if Is_Record_Type (Desig_T) then
            Append_List_To (Stmts, Cleanup_Record (N, Arg, Desig_T));

         elsif Is_Array_Type (Desig_T) then
            Append_List_To (Stmts, Cleanup_Array (N, Arg, Desig_T));
         end if;
      end if;

      --  Same for simple protected types. Eventually call Finalize_Protection
      --  before freeing the PO for each protected component.

      if Is_Simple_Protected_Type (Desig_T) then
         Append_To (Stmts,
           Cleanup_Protected_Object (N, Duplicate_Subexpr_No_Checks (Arg)));

      elsif Has_Simple_Protected_Object (Desig_T) then
         if Is_Record_Type (Desig_T) then
            Append_List_To (Stmts, Cleanup_Record (N, Arg, Desig_T));
         elsif Is_Array_Type (Desig_T) then
            Append_List_To (Stmts, Cleanup_Array (N, Arg, Desig_T));
         end if;
      end if;

      --  Normal processing for non-controlled types

      Free_Arg := Duplicate_Subexpr_No_Checks (Arg);
      Free_Node := Make_Free_Statement (Loc, Empty);
      Append_To (Stmts, Free_Node);
      Set_Storage_Pool (Free_Node, Pool);

      --  Attach to tree before analysis of generated subtypes below

      Set_Parent (Stmts, Parent (N));

      --  Deal with storage pool

      if Present (Pool) then

         --  Freeing the secondary stack is meaningless

         if Is_RTE (Pool, RE_SS_Pool) then
            null;

         --  If the pool object is of a simple storage pool type, then attempt
         --  to locate the type's Deallocate procedure, if any, and set the
         --  free operation's procedure to call. If the type doesn't have a
         --  Deallocate (which is allowed), then the actual will simply be set
         --  to null.

         elsif Present (Get_Rep_Pragma
                          (Etype (Pool), Name_Simple_Storage_Pool_Type))
         then
            declare
               Pool_Type  : constant Entity_Id := Base_Type (Etype (Pool));
               Dealloc_Op : Entity_Id;
            begin
               Dealloc_Op := Get_Name_Entity_Id (Name_Deallocate);
               while Present (Dealloc_Op) loop
                  if Scope (Dealloc_Op) = Scope (Pool_Type)
                    and then Present (First_Formal (Dealloc_Op))
                    and then Etype (First_Formal (Dealloc_Op)) = Pool_Type
                  then
                     Set_Procedure_To_Call (Free_Node, Dealloc_Op);
                     exit;
                  else
                     Dealloc_Op := Homonym (Dealloc_Op);
                  end if;
               end loop;
            end;

         --  Case of a class-wide pool type: make a dispatching call to
         --  Deallocate through the class-wide Deallocate_Any.

         elsif Is_Class_Wide_Type (Etype (Pool)) then
            Set_Procedure_To_Call (Free_Node, RTE (RE_Deallocate_Any));

         --  Case of a specific pool type: make a statically bound call

         else
            Set_Procedure_To_Call (Free_Node,
              Find_Prim_Op (Etype (Pool), Name_Deallocate));
         end if;
      end if;

      if Present (Procedure_To_Call (Free_Node)) then

         --  For all cases of a Deallocate call, the back-end needs to be able
         --  to compute the size of the object being freed. This may require
         --  some adjustments for objects of dynamic size.
         --
         --  If the type is class wide, we generate an implicit type with the
         --  right dynamic size, so that the deallocate call gets the right
         --  size parameter computed by GIGI. Same for an access to
         --  unconstrained packed array.

         if Is_Class_Wide_Type (Desig_T)
           or else
            (Is_Array_Type (Desig_T)
              and then not Is_Constrained (Desig_T)
              and then Is_Packed (Desig_T))
         then
            declare
               Deref    : constant Node_Id :=
                            Make_Explicit_Dereference (Loc,
                              Duplicate_Subexpr_No_Checks (Arg));
               D_Subtyp : Node_Id;
               D_Type   : Entity_Id;

            begin
               --  Perform minor decoration as it is needed by the side effect
               --  removal mechanism.

               Set_Etype  (Deref, Desig_T);
               Set_Parent (Deref, Free_Node);
               D_Subtyp := Make_Subtype_From_Expr (Deref, Desig_T);

               if Nkind (D_Subtyp) in N_Has_Entity then
                  D_Type := Entity (D_Subtyp);

               else
                  D_Type := Make_Temporary (Loc, 'A');
                  Insert_Action (Deref,
                    Make_Subtype_Declaration (Loc,
                      Defining_Identifier => D_Type,
                      Subtype_Indication  => D_Subtyp));
               end if;

               --  Force freezing at the point of the dereference. For the
               --  class wide case, this avoids having the subtype frozen
               --  before the equivalent type.

               Freeze_Itype (D_Type, Deref);

               Set_Actual_Designated_Subtype (Free_Node, D_Type);
            end;

         end if;
      end if;

      --  Ada 2005 (AI-251): In case of abstract interface type we must
      --  displace the pointer to reference the base of the object to
      --  deallocate its memory, unless we're targetting a VM, in which case
      --  no special processing is required.

      --  Generate:
      --    free (Base_Address (Obj_Ptr))

      if Is_Interface (Directly_Designated_Type (Typ))
        and then Tagged_Type_Expansion
      then
         Set_Expression (Free_Node,
           Unchecked_Convert_To (Typ,
             Make_Function_Call (Loc,
               Name => New_Occurrence_Of (RTE (RE_Base_Address), Loc),
               Parameter_Associations => New_List (
                 Unchecked_Convert_To (RTE (RE_Address), Free_Arg)))));

      --  Generate:
      --    free (Obj_Ptr)

      else
         Set_Expression (Free_Node, Free_Arg);
      end if;

      --  Only remaining step is to set result to null, or generate a raise of
      --  Constraint_Error if the target object is "not null".

      if Can_Never_Be_Null (Etype (Arg)) then
         Append_To (Stmts,
           Make_Raise_Constraint_Error (Loc,
             Reason => CE_Access_Check_Failed));

      else
         declare
            Lhs : constant Node_Id := Duplicate_Subexpr_No_Checks (Arg);
         begin
            Set_Assignment_OK (Lhs);
            Append_To (Stmts,
              Make_Assignment_Statement (Loc,
                Name       => Lhs,
                Expression => Make_Null (Loc)));
         end;
      end if;

      --  Generate a test of whether any earlier finalization raised an
      --  exception, and in that case raise Program_Error with the previous
      --  exception occurrence.

      --  Generate:
      --    if Raised and then not Abort then
      --       raise Program_Error;                  --  for .NET and
      --                                             --  restricted RTS
      --         <or>
      --       Raise_From_Controlled_Operation (E);  --  all other cases
      --    end if;

      if Needs_Fin then
         Append_To (Stmts, Build_Raise_Statement (Finalizer_Data));
      end if;

      --  If we know the argument is non-null, then make a block statement
      --  that contains the required statements, no need for a test.

      if Arg_Known_Non_Null then
         Gen_Code :=
           Make_Block_Statement (Loc,
             Handled_Statement_Sequence =>
               Make_Handled_Sequence_Of_Statements (Loc,
             Statements => Stmts));

      --  If the argument may be null, wrap the statements inside an IF that
      --  does an explicit test to exclude the null case.

      else
         Gen_Code :=
           Make_Implicit_If_Statement (N,
             Condition =>
               Make_Op_Ne (Loc,
                 Left_Opnd  => Duplicate_Subexpr (Arg),
                 Right_Opnd => Make_Null (Loc)),
             Then_Statements => Stmts);
      end if;

      --  Rewrite the call

      Rewrite (N, Gen_Code);
      Analyze (N);

      --  If we generated a block with an At_End_Proc, expand the exception
      --  handler. We need to wait until after everything else is analyzed.

      if Present (Blk) then
         Expand_At_End_Handler
           (Handled_Statement_Sequence (Blk), Entity (Identifier (Blk)));
      end if;
   end Expand_Unc_Deallocation;
